On Wavelet Estimation of the Derivatives of a Density Based on Biased Data

Author

Listed:
  • Yogendra P. Chaubey
  • Esmaeil Shirazi

Abstract

Here, we consider wavelet based estimation of the derivatives of a probability density function under random sampling from a weighted distribution and extend the results regarding the asymptotic convergence rates under the i.i.d. setup studied in Prakasa Rao (1996) to the biased-data setup. We compare the performance of the wavelet based estimator with that of the kernel based estimator obtained by differentiating the Efromovich (2004) kernel density estimator through a simulation study.
